概括
与对照组相比,第一发抑郁症患者表现出胰岛素类生长因子-1 (IGF-1) 水平升高. 这项研究强调了需要在涉及IGF-1的抑郁症研究中仔细考虑混因素的需要.

背景情况:
- 类似胰岛素的生长因子-1 (IGF-1) 具有神经营养特性,影响神经发生,回髓化和突触发生.
- IGF-1被认为是神经元可塑性的调节者.
- 虽然IGF-1在抑郁症中的作用正在研究中,但对第一期,未使用过药物的患者的研究是有限的.
研究的目的:
- 在没有先前使用抗抑郁药的情况下经历了首次抑郁发作的患者中检查血清IGF-1水平.
- 为了比较IGF-1水平在第一次发作,药物前的抑郁症患者和匹配的健康对照者之间.
- 为了补充IGF-1在抑郁障碍中的现有证据.
主要方法:
- 一项病例对照研究,涉及60名首发,未服用药物的抑郁症患者和60名匹配的健康对照.
- 在抑郁症组和对照组之间比较了血清IGF-1水平.
- 为了验证发现,对13项现有病例控制研究进行了元分析.
主要成果:
- 与健康对照人群相比,初发,未服用药物的抑郁症患者的血清IGF-1水平显著更高 (p<0.05).
- 在抑郁症组中,性别之间没有观察到IGF-1水平的显著差异.
- 在血清IGF-1水平和年龄或抑郁症严重程度之间没有发现显著的相关性.
结论:
- 第一个情节,以前没有服用过药物的抑郁症与血清IGF-1水平升高有关.
- 在研究IGF-1在抑郁症中的研究中,仔细排除混因素至关重要.
- 需要进一步的研究来阐明IGF-1在抑郁症中的确切作用.

G-protein coupled receptors are ligand binding receptors that indirectly affect changes in the cell. The actual receptor is a single polypeptide that transverses the cell membrane seven times creating intracellular and extracellular loops. The extracellular loops create a ligand specific pocket which binds to neurotransmitters or hormones. The intracellular loops holds onto the G-protein.
